Amex Membership Rewards Transfer Bonus, Get 15% More LifeMiles (1:1.15)
The regular transfer rate is 1000 Membership Rewards points = 1000 Life Miles. So with this promotion you can transfer 1000 Membership Rewards points and receive 1150 LifeMiles.

Chase Sapphire Reserve Exclusive Tables: Get Free Drinks at Select Restaurants with Visa Concierge
Before you book your next restaurant through Sapphire Reserve Exclusive Tables, you should check Visa Concierge to see if you can also get some extra freebies. Some restaurants give you drinks for everyone in your party, some desserts, and some both.

SoFi Checking and Savings Adding Instant Transfers
The SoFi Checking and Savings account is adding instant transfers. The new feature is already live for incoming transfers that use Federal Reserve’s FedNow, and it will soon be available for outgoing transfers as well.
